About The Position

The Concessions Cook is responsible for preparing concession menu items per specifications and/or company recipes utilizing cooking equipment in a fast-paced environment. The Concession Cook must adhere to high food quality standards to ensure guest satisfaction. Portion control, food waste, and sanitation are additional areas that the Concession Cook must be aware of while operating in the concession stand.

Responsibilities

  • Demonstrate ability to meet the company standard for excellence in the areas of guest service, interaction with co-workers, and uniform standards.
  • Take pride in personal appearance, reporting to work in neat and clean clothing and maintaining well-groomed hair and personal hygiene as established by company policy.
  • Responsible for cooking and packing food products that are prepared to order or kept warm until sold.
  • Responsible for portion control and serving temperatures of all products prepared and sold.
  • Receive verbal orders from the front counter staff for food product requirements for guest orders.
  • Responsible for maintaining quality and production standards on all menu items. Food must be fresh and of high quality when served to the guests.
  • Responsible for cleaning, stocking, and restocking of workstations and displays.
  • Request additional product as required in a timely manner prior to running out.
  • Responsible for operating large-volume cooking equipment such as grills, deep-fat fryers, and ovens.
  • Ensure that all work areas and equipment are clean, food products are properly stored, utensils are clean and put away, and the floor is swept and mopped at the end of the shift.
  • Maintains sanitation, health, and safety standards in work areas.
